In the coming week, from March 4 to 8, 2024, some trees will be felled in the Berlin district of Rahnsdorf and in Niederschöneweide. The measure is necessary to ensure traffic safety. In the Rahnsdorf, a tree will be felled in the Bauernheideweg on March 4, 2024. It is a linden tree with the tree no. 17/1, a trunk diameter of 207 cm and a height of 21 m. The precipitation is required due to the stem and rootstock mechanism, fungal attack and threatening risk of overthrow

in Niederschöneweide, another tree will be felled on March 7, 2024 on the playground on Britzer Strasse.
